Open up vbtestimonials.php

FIND:
PHP Code:

$pmdm->save(); 

REPLACE WITH:
PHP Code:

//$pmdm->save(); 

ADD UNDER:
PHP Code:

print $pmdm->errors

SAVE AND TRY AGAIN.

It should print out the error.

derekivey 08-17-2006 11:20 PM

Check and see if the vbtestimonials_ tables exist in the database. If they do, see if there is anything in them (click on one of them and click Browse at the top of PHPMyAdmin). If the stuff is already there, you should be able to install it in the product manager and continue to use it as normal.
